Grounding

The equipment must be grounded. Grounding 
reduces the risk of static and electric shock by pro-
viding an escape wire for the electrical current due 
to static build up or in the event of a short circuit.

Connect power cord to a 3-wire grounded plug 
according to your local electrical code. The green 
ground wire must be attached to the green ground-
ing screw in plug.
